A wire of length 2 m is made from 10 cm³ of copper. A force F is applied so that its length increases by 2 mm. Another wire of length 8 m is made from the same volume of copper. If the force F is applied to it, its length will increase by

Options

(a) 0.8 cm
(b) 1.6 cm
(c) 2.4 cm
(d) 3.2 cm

Correct Answer:

3.2 cm
